When I scan and send documents by email using my HP Envy 7640 (with a copy to myself) I see "eprintc..." as the sender, but I have no proof that they were successfully sent to the other destinee(s). There should be a way to know that the sending to them was successful.

ePrint does not like "CC" (Copy to other recipients) and it does not accept multiple "to" addresses.

Send to one recipient.

 

User Guide

Page 33

 

Partial Excerpt from the page:

NOTE: The ePrint server does not accept email print jobs if there are multiple email addresses
included in the "To" or "Cc" fields. Only enter the HP ePrint email address in the "To" field. Do not enter
any additional email addresses in the other fields

Indicators for having successfully sent / received / printed the content are very limited.

Even having done everything correctly, there is only a limited response / mail-back to indicate the mail was sent.

Read the ePrint section in the User Guide...

and

For example, the "Send from" (owner email address) will / might receive a mail from the ePrint service with the subject line "ePrint Job Received".
